The caregivers at the Lafayette Senior Care center are trained to conduct a sort of Psycho-Social Assessment. At the time of assessment, the caregiver looks into several aspects like:

• The person’s emotional and health status

• Managing his medicinal requirements

• His safety at home

• The sort of social activities the person must take part in

• His family strength and all round social assistance

• His scope and ability to lead an independent and disease free life
